Key performance indicators (KPIs) help managers gauge the effectiveness of various functions, processes and performance important to achieving organizational goals. A metric is a quantifiable measure that is used to track and assess the status of a specific process or performance. In a data context, measures are the numbers or values that can be summed and/or averaged, such as sales, leads, distances, durations, temperatures, and weight. If measure sounds similar to KPI, think of it like this: measures are numbers/values; KPIs are context-driven and are often made up of multiple measures. Both metrics and KPIs rely on and are derived from measures.
